2006 Alfa Romeo Brera vs. 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ander

To start off, both 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era and 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ander were released in the same year (2006).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,195 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era (256 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 96 more horse power than 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ander. (160 HP @ 5750 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era should accelerate faster than 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ander weights approximately 80 kg more than 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era (322 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 102 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ander. (220 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2006 Alfa Romeo Brera will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ander.

Compare all specifications:

2006 Alfa Romeo Brera 2006 Mitsubishi Outlander
Make Alfa Romeo Mitsubishi
Model Brera Outlander
Year Released 2006 2006
Body Type Hatchback S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3195 cc 2375 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 5 valves
Horse Power 256 HP 160 HP
Engine RPM 6200 RPM 5750 RPM
Torque 322 Nm 220 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 4000 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 11.3:1 9.5: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type 4WD 4WD
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1705 kg 1785 kg
Vehicle Length 4420 mm 4550 mm
Vehicle Width 1840 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1690 mm
Wheelbase Size 2530 mm 2630 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 11.5 L/100km 10.7 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 70 L 59 L
